Audi outline roadmap for French wonderkid for F1 team

Theo Pourchaire is one of the most exciting prospects in Formula 1, with the 19-year-old having already completed two seasons of F2 racing despite his young age. Pourchaire finished second in this year’s series and has suggested that this might be the last time he takes part in F2, as the cost is beginning to outweigh the benefits. “This is my last F2 season for sure, financially it won’t be possible,” he said.
